College to discuss campus recycling efforts

Morningside College students, faculty, and staff will examine campus recycling efforts during a program at 11:45 a.m. Wednesday, Sept. 26, in the UPS Auditorium of the Lincoln Center, 3627 Peters Ave.

The public is invited to the free event, which is co-sponsored by Morningside’s Academic and Cultural Arts Series (ACAS) and the Recycling and Environmental Committee.

The program will include a “State of the Recycling” report from Ray Turner, also known as “Cardboard Bob.” He is a Sioux City entrepreneur who picks up recyclable materials each week from Morningside College and other area locations.

It will also feature a video about recycling created by Morningside student Brian Johnson, as well as a panel discussion with Turner; students Anthony Rezac and Phil Lieder; and Sharona Ernst, the Americorps Volunteers in Service to America service learning coordinator. The panel discussion will be moderated by Kathy Olson, campus pastor and director of church relations.

Those who attend the program will be invited to guess how many pounds or tons of materials were recycled by the campus between Jan. 1 and June 30 of this year, and the winner will receive a free personal recycle bin.
